Bilingual Data Entry Receptionist
Data entry specialist job in North Las Vegas, NV
Ultimate Staffing Services is actively seeking a Bilingual Data Entry Receptionist for a temporary role in a dynamic construction environment in Nevada. This position offers the potential to transition into a full-time role. The ideal candidate will be bilingual and possess strong data entry skills to effectively manage invoices and other administrative tasks.
Responsibilities
Manage data entry of invoices, approximately 300+ per week, including printing, date stamping, logging unapproved invoices, matching with purchase orders, and submitting for approval.
Organize and move emails to the shared drive, ensuring proper documentation and accessibility.
Verify fuel logs and perform scanning duties as required.
Operate within Trimble (formerly Viewpoint), similar to Sage software, to manage data and processes.
Maintain the kitchen area by unpacking and stocking the fridge and snacks, taking out trash, and general cleanup. General office tasks
Handle phone calls and manage the lobby area, although the volume is typically low.
Work independently in a quiet office setting, with occasional interaction with field workers.
Ensure attire is casual but professional; no ripped jeans or flip flops.
Requirements
Bilingual proficiency is required.
Strong data entry skills with attention to detail and the ability to review and think through information.
Ability to work independently and manage tasks efficiently.
Previous experience in a construction environment is a plus.
Required Work Hours
Monday through Friday, first shift.

Data Process Utility Specialist
Data entry specialist job in Las Vegas, NV
Job Title:
Data Process Utility Specialist
What you'll do:
As a Data Process Utility Specialist you'll be supporting the Bank's Receivables Operation which enables customers to accept electronic and traditional paper-based payments. You'll support the capture of remittance information to create output files and reporting for internal and external clients. You'll work with a team of Receivables Processors to expedite processing and posting of payments while focusing on providing a high level of customer service. One of your key responsibilities is to support a team of Receivables Processors to ensure the operational functions are completed within SLAs while maintaining accuracy goals. You'll serve as the subject matter expert in one or more of the receivables areas and will provide operational monitoring, research assistance, and bank wide support.
Responsible for supporting the Receivables Supervisor by providing a client eccentric experience while ensuring consistent, timely and accurate payment execution.
Execute a variety of routine tasks which may include sorting mail, extracting payments and/or correspondence, reviewing payments to ensure accuracy, and scanning of deposits using high speed optical scanners, and applying account receivables to client accounts. Ensure processing deadlines are met prior to cutoff times.
Assist the Receivables team in training and development, performs advanced research and handles high priority items.
What you'll need:
2+ years of related experience in Branch Banking Operations or similar field.
High school diploma required.
Intermediate knowledge of general banking operations, including deposit operations, loan administration, treasury management and/or other commercial banking products and services.
Intermediate knowledge of applicable regulatory and legal compliance obligations, rules and regulations, industry standards and practices.
Back office receivables operations experience.
Ability to 10 key by touch and perform alphanumeric data entry with a high level of accuracy.
Intermediate speaking and writing communication skills.

Auto-ApplyRobot Data Processing Specialist
Data entry specialist job in Las Vegas, NV
THE JOB As a Robot Data Processing Specialist, you will be responsible for managing the end-to-end lifecycle of data collected from robotic systems - from structured collection and parsing, to cleaning, formatting, visualization, and preparing datasets for machine learning and engineering teams. This role requires technical fluency in robot data formats, basic scripting, and a strong focus on data quality and structure.
THE DAY-TO-DAY
* Collect and organize multimodal data generated from robot operation sessions (video, IMU, joint state, control inputs, etc.)
* Parse and process structured robot data using formats such as Protobuf, ROS bags, and URDF
* Visualize robot movement and sensor data using Foxglove or custom dashboards
* Perform routine data cleaning, integrity checks, and filtering of corrupted, noisy, or incomplete data
* Maintain internal dataset structure, metadata consistency, and naming/versioning standards
* Collaborate with robotics engineers and ML teams to ensure data is usable, labeled, and scalable
* Contribute to improving data pipelines and internal tooling for automation and visualization
THE IDEAL CANDIDATE
You're deeply organized, hands-on, and understand the value of structured, clean data in robotics and AI systems. You've worked with real robot data or simulation logs, and you're comfortable reading URDF files, visualizing sensor data, or scripting to clean and format logs. You might not be a full ML engineer, but you know what high-quality training data looks like - and how to build it.
QUALIFICATIONS
* Familiarity with robotics data structures: URDF, Protobuf, ROS topics/bags
* Experience with robot data visualization tools such as Foxglove.
* Proficiency in Python or other scripting languages for automation, parsing, and formatting
* Strong understanding of Linux environments, file systems, and version control
* Experience working with large data sets in robotics, simulation, or embedded systems
* Background in Machine Learning or Data Annotation workflows is preferred
*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Robotics, Data Engineering, or a related field
Sr Spatial Data Specialist
Data entry specialist job in Las Vegas, NV
**About Us** Freeman is a global leader in events, on a mission to redefine live for a new era. With a data-driven approach and the industry' largest network of experts, Freeman's insights shape exhibitions, exhibits, and events that drive audiences to action. The integrated full-service solutions leverage a 97-year legacy in event management as well as new technologies to deliver moments that matter.
**Summary**
The Senior Spatial Data Specialist is a key technical and strategic individual contributor with deep expertise in spatial data systems, architectural assets, and media formats. Responsible for developing and managing the systems, standards, and services that centralize built-environment data across the enterprise. This role bridges the AEC, media, and creative production worlds, ensuring that spatial data - from scans to BIM models and digital twins - is captured, cataloged, and optimized for creative, planning, and production teams.
This individual combines advanced knowledge of spatial data formats (BIM Models, CAD, GIS Layers, PLY, 3DGS) with creative vision to build scalable, future-ready systems that drive visualization, design, and storytelling workflows. They champion the establishment of spatial data services, pipelines, and governance models that convert raw environmental data into valuable creative assets.
This position will support our Design team. It is eligible to work a hybrid schedule, generally requiring work in-office and/or show site 2-3 days per week. The ideal candidate will be based out of any of the following locations:
+ Las Vegas, NV
+ Dallas, TX
**Essential Duties & Responsibilities**
**Platform Strategy & Architecture**
- Design and direct the enterprise spatial data platform, unifying architectural, geospatial, and media data.
- Set standards for data formats, metadata schemas, and interoperability across BIM, CAD, GIS (ESRI, QGIS), LiDAR, and 3D media environments.
- Establish data lifecycle governance for ingestion, version control, access, and archiving.
- Own platform KPIs including adoption rates, data accuracy, and stakeholder satisfaction to ensure enterprise-wide value.
**Data Capture & Vendor Leadership**
- Define best practices for environment capture workflows.
- Lead vendor analysis, onboarding, and performance oversight for scanning and 3D environment capture providers.
- Develop quality assurance and intake protocols to guarantee precise, consistent spatial data assets.
- Coordinate with regional teams and vendors to manage on-site data capture activities and resolve real-time operational challenges.
**Creative Enablement & Integration**
- Collaborate with Creative, Strategy, and Growth teams to ensure spatial and visual data is accessible for concepting, visualization, and storytelling.
- Develop pipelines to bring built environment data into creative platforms such as AutoCAD, SketchUp, and Adobe tools.
- Act as an advisor to creative and experience design leaders on spatial data applications.
- Partner with Real Estate, Operations, and Growth teams to align spatial data capabilities with business needs.
**Innovation & Emerging Technologies**
- Explore and implement AI-assisted modeling, real-time digital twins, AR/VR/MR, and spatial analytics to enable design and production.
- Collaborate with Data, Technology, and Creative Innovation teams to implement new tools for automated environment reconstruction, asset tagging, and generative visualization.
- Continuously evaluate emerging AEC and spatial media technologies to future-proof enterprise capabilities.
**Education & Experience**
- 7+ years of experience in AEC data management, environment capture, or spatial media systems, ideally bridging architectural and creative pipelines.
- Bachelor's degree preferred, High School Diploma or Equivalent with relevant work experience required
- Deep understanding of AEC and spatial formats (Revit, DWG, OBJ, USD, 3DGS, etc.)
- Experience with BIM/GIS integration, 3D scanning workflows (LiDAR, 3DGS), and asset management platforms.
- Demonstrated ability to lead cross-functional and vendor teams to design and operationalize new systems and standards.
- Strong knowledge of metadata design, taxonomy, and data governance.
- Familiarity with AI/ML techniques for spatial data processing, segmentation, or classification.
- Understanding of cloud data architectures (AWS, Snowflake) and APIs for spatial data interoperability.
